Card condition remains paramount, assessed through centering, edge quality, corners, and print clarity. Professional grading validates these elements and authenticates autographs if present. Player popularity, recent auction or sales results, and card rarity drive market value, alongside whether the card is raw or slabbed. Grading can enhance value, especially for vintage and high-demand rookies, but balance the costs against potential benefits.
A mix of vintage rarity and modern rookie desirability influences value. Both categories attract buyers, depending on condition and player significance.
Complete sets can appeal to certain buyers; organized collections with well-documented conditions tend to sell better.
Researching recent sales, consulting apps, and obtaining expert opinions can help evaluate card worth.
